Dorityle 500 Injection contains Doripenem (500mg), a broad-spectrum carbapenem antibiotic used to treat serious bacterial infections. Doripenem works by inhibiting bacterial cell wall synthesis, which effectively kills bacteria. It is especially useful against multidrug-resistant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ria, including those causing hospital-acquired infections.
It helps in the treatment of complicated infections such as urinary tract infections, intra-abdominal infections, pneumonia (including ventilator-associated pneumonia), skin and soft tissue infections, and bloodstream infections, particularly in critically ill or hospitalized patients.
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, headache, rash, or pain at the injection site. Rarely, it may cause allergic reactions, seizures (especially in patients with kidney problems), or liver and kidney function changes.
Used for moderate to severe bacterial infections involving the urinary tract, lungs, abdomen, bloodstream, and skin. It is often prescribed when infections are caused by resistant organisms or when first-line antibiotics are ineffective.
Administer only under the supervision of a healthcare professional. Inform your doctor of any history of kidney disease, seizures, or allergies to beta-lactam antibiotics (penicillins, cephalosporins, carbapenems). Complete the full prescribed course to prevent resistance.
Store below 25°C in a dry place, protected from light. Reconstituted solution should be used immediately or as advised by a medical professional. Keep out of reach of children.
